如何自建手机版工作日志app

想要自建一个手机版工作日志APP,需要了解一些基础的知识和原理。简单来说,手机版工作日志APP的核心就是将用户的工作日志数据存储到服务器上,并提供一个方便用户访问的接口。下面我们将会根据这一核心来详细介绍如何自建手机版工作日志APP。

1. 选取合适的技术

在开发手机版工作日志APP之前,我们需要了解一些主流的开发技术和框架。如今,iOS和Android移动开发已经成为主流,开发者可以选择相应的开发语言和框架进行开发。

对于iOS开发,Swift是苹果推出的一种全新的编程语言,其易读性较高,开发效率较高,适合用来开发iOS应用。对于Android开发,Android Studio是一个比较成熟的开发工具,可以使用Java或Kotlin语言进行开发。

在选择技术时,还需要考虑到用户的需求。比如用户的操作系统版本和常用设备等因素,以便确定开发的方向和技术。

2. 设计APP的界面

在选择技术之后,我们需要设计界面。工作日志APP需要简单易用,方便用户记录自己的工作日志。所以,在设计过程中需要注重用户体验。

界面应该简洁明了,不应该过于复杂和花哨。用户可以快速选择工作类别、输入工作内容和工作时间,然后轻松地提交工作记录。

3. 集成后端

选择开发技术和设计用户界面后,我们需要将客户端和服务器进行集成,以便让用户记录的工作日志能够保存到服务器上,同时也方便用户在不同设备上访问工作日志记录。

对于后端技术,我们可以选择Java、Python、PHP等编程语言进行开发。后端技术需要收集、存储、管理和分析用户数据,同时还需要提供用户访问的API接口。

服务器应该选择可靠的云服务器,具有高可用性和高性能的云服务器可以保证用户数据的安全和可靠性。

4. 设置安全保护机制

在开发工作日志APP时,安全保护机制是非常重要的。用户的工作日志属于个人隐私,如果泄露或被黑客攻击,将会造成不可估量的损失。

因此,在开发APP时,需要考虑到防护措施,设置安全保护机制。例如,为用户数据加密和设置权限认证等。

5. 集成第三方服务

为了提供更好的用户体验,我们可以使用第三方服务,如Push消息推送服务或数据分析服务等。这些服务可以帮助我们更好地管理和分析用户数据,并为用户提供更好的体验。

6. 测试和修复

在开发工作日志APP时,测试和修复是必不可少的环节。测试可以帮助我们及时发现问题,修复问题后可以提高APP的稳定性和用户体验。

最后,将工作日志APP发布到相应的应用商店中,让更多的用户能够使用和体验。

总结

以上就是自建手机版工作日志APP的主要步骤。需要了解某些开发技术和框架,设计用户界面,集成后端,设置安全保护机制,集成第三方服务,并进行测试和修复等。只有站在用户的角度,注重用户体验并保证数据安全,才能够开发出一款受用户欢迎的工作日志APP。


相关知识:
自做解压文件app
解压文件是我们在电脑使用过程中常常遇到的操作之一。为了更加方便用户使用,很多开发者开发了不同的解压工具软件。但是,有些特定文件格式的解压软件并不一定存在或者不是很好用,这时,自己开发一个解压文件的应用程序就是一个不错的选择。本文将讲述自做解压文件App的原
2023-06-05
自用安卓app开发
自用安卓app开发是指开发者为自己打造一个适用于个人使用的应用程序,通常不涉及商业用途。本文将从原理、步骤和注意事项三个方面详细介绍自用安卓app开发的过程。一、原理自用安卓app的开发需要具备以下技能:Java语言、Android Studio集成开发环
2023-06-05
自己做的app别人用也能看到新内容
当我们开发了一款app后,如果需要实现让别人在使用我们的应用时能够看到新的内容,一般有两种方式实现。一、通过网络请求获取最新内容我们可以通过网络请求来获取最新内容,一旦有了新内容,我们可以将这些新内容以某种方式展现给用户。常见的方式有以下两种。1. 使用推
2023-06-05
制作自己的商铺app
现在手机应用程式已经成为人类生活必不可少的一部分,每个人手机里面都会有几十个不同的应用程式。对于企业来说,自己的应用程式那么重要吗?当一个消费者需要购买一件商品时,想想它们会查找谁,第一个想到的就是使用手机寻找合适的商铺app,因此,制作自己的商铺APP,
2023-06-05
怎么在手机上自己开发一款app
在手机上开发一款App可以分为几个步骤,包括确定开发工具、设计App、编写代码、测试和发布,下面详细介绍这些步骤。确定开发工具在开发App之前,需要选择一个适合自己的开发工具,常见的包括Android Studio、Xcode和Appcelerator等,
2023-06-05
什么app可以自己做书
现在随着移动设备和智能手机越来越多的应用程序厂商开发了一些自己的做书软件,这使得作者可以自己做一本电子书。由于选项众多,我们并不能过分地推荐任何一个自己做书软件,但是我们可以简要介绍几个较为受欢迎的自己做书的应用,并阐述它们的原理和特点。1. iBooks
2023-05-31
哪个手机app 支持自建词库
近年来,语音输入和智能输入已经成为智能手机的必备功能之一。随着大数据、人工智能和大规模计算的发展,自然语言处理技术正在逐步成熟。因此,众多的手机App开始支持自建词库的功能,以满足用户的需求。自建词库是指用户可以根据自己的需求,将一些经常使用但是不在系统默
2023-05-30
你可以自己做的词汇app手机版
做词汇APP用于学习的流程如下:1. 设计阶段:首先要明确词汇APP的主要功能,目标用户和用户需求。通过市场调查和用户反馈等方式,确定APP的市场定位和功能模块。2. 界面设计:设计用户友好的界面元素,包括图标、按钮、输入框、下拉菜单等。在设计时要考虑用户
2023-05-30
简单免费自建app别人可以搜索到
自建app可以让你获得更好的控制权,以及让你的网站或业务得到更多曝光机会。此外,自建app也可以提高用户体验,增加用户黏性,加快页面响应速度。现在,以下是一些简单免费的方法来自建app。1. 基于web技术的app:这是比较简单的一种方法。基于web技术的
2023-05-30
iphone如何运行自己开发的app
苹果公司在iOS系统中加入了App Store应用商店,可以在App Store中下载和购买应用程序,而开发者也可以在苹果公司的开发平台上开发自己的应用程序。开发完成后,如何在iPhone上运行自己开发的App呢?首先,开发者需要在自己的苹果开发平台帐户下
2023-05-30
app自主开发和委托开发
随着移动互联网的发展,越来越多的企业或个人开始考虑开发一个自己的app。而在实际开发过程中,可以选择自主开发或者委托开发。本文将就这两种方式进行详细介绍和原理分析。一、自主开发自主开发是指企业或个人自己设计、开发和维护自己的app,拥有完全的自主权。开发者
2023-05-30
app自己开发与外包
应用程序 (App) 自开发和外包的选择,对于许多企业和机构决策者来说,都是一个不断讨论的话题。在进行决策之前,需要了解自己的目标,以及自己企业和机构的需求和要求。本文将从原理和详细介绍两个方面,对这两种方案进行探讨和比较。## 自开发自开发指的是企业或机
2023-05-30
©2015-2021 自建app开发平台 www.appbyme.cn 蜀ICP备17005078号-1